The correct answer is a: The people behind us in line (at least a dozen by our count) arrived too late to get tickets. Parentheses () are often used to enclose additional information, a short explanation, an example, or comment. In this example, there is no need to capitalize the first letter within the parentheses. The last choice is a run-on sentence and incorrect.
